Brussels MIM — Museum of Musical Instruments — In this museum dedicated to musical instruments, the visitor can hear the sounds of all of them! Rue Montagne de la Cour 2, in 1000 Brussels — www.mim.fgov.be Museés Royaux des Beaux Arts — these gather two Museums : one is dedicated to ancient art and the other one to modern art. Both boast samples of the very best artist of world art history. Not to be missed — Place Royale 1-2 and Rue de la Régence 3 in 1000 Brussels www.fine-arts-museum.be

Brussels Mini Europe - this is the best miniature park in Europe, featuring model sample of each capital and of best ‘features' of the European Union members — where else can attend at the same time a Vesuvius eruption, the fall of the Berlin wall, a Seville Corrida and watch the launch of the Ariane V rocket?! — Brupark, Heysel, 1020 Brussels (at the bottom of the Atomium) — www.minieurope.com

Auto-World — one of the richest collections of veteran cars in Europe, situated in a remarkable building of the Cinquantenaire Park. — 11 Prac du Cinquantenaire, in 1000 Brussels, - www.autoworld.be


Magritte Museum – The city’s Royal Museum of Fine Arts on rue du Musée is worth seeing in its own right. But from June 2, the building behind will open as the Magritte Museum, dedicated to the artist from Wallonia, whose witty and thought-provokating surrealist paintings have made him a household name. The museum will contain 200 of Magritte’s work from different stages of his life. www.magrittemuseum.be (closes on Mondays).
